Looking for a new beauty regime for the new year? Then what better place to start than with the organic, Australian products from INDAH Organics. As of the middle of December, the full INDAH Collection has been available online, through selected organic stores, specialised boutiques and spas and will soon be available through supermarket chain IGA. Launched in 2008 by Australian model and wellness warrior Teisha Lowry, the range brings sustainable beauty and ethical style together in a range of body butters, hand creams, body and perfume balms and Extra Virgin Coconut Oil. Better yet, by purchasing the Coconut Oil, you are also supporting village communities in East Bali who handmake it. We love the delicious body butters with names like Sari and Dreamland and the range also includes a perfume created especially for Australian designer Alice McCall!
